Skip to Main Content

Festival Center

Category Nonprofit

Address

1640 Columbia Rd NW
Washington, DC 20009

visit website

View on Google Maps

Social Media

Details

A hub for activists, artists, people of faith and no faith, seekers, and mission-driven groups

Nearby Dining

Nearby Shopping

Nearby Services